作者:乔山办公网日期:
返回目录:excel表格制作
需要运用GET.CELL函数和Sumif函数。Get.CELL函数不能直接用,百要自定义函数。假设目标区域是Sheet1A1:C3,具体如下:
1、菜单度-插入-名称-定义(2007以上版本是公式管理器),输入任意名称(如:判断颜色1),在“ 引用位置”问中输入“=GET.CELL(24,A1)”,确定。公式中24为字符颜色,如果需要单元答格颜色,将24改为63即可。
2、将A1:C3整体复制到专另一区域,然后选中第一个单元格,输入=判断颜色1,拉公式把上述区域填满。
3、用sumif公式统计属Get.Cell区域统计出来的带颜色字体返回的数字即可。
根据百单元格填充颜色求和如下介绍:
第一步,将光标定位到A12单元格,单击菜单插入——名称——定义,弹出定义名称对话框,在“在当前工作簿中的名称”下面输入“hhh”,在“引用位置”下面输入:度=GET.CELL(63,Sheet1!A1:G10),单击“确定”关闭定义名称对话框。
第二步,选中A12:G21单元格区域,在编辑栏输入:=hhh,按下CTRL+回车键确定。即可得到有颜色的单元格的颜色代码,红颜色为3。
第三步,在D23单元格输入公式:=SUMIF(A12:G21,3,A1:G10),得到A1:G10单元格区域颜色为红色版的数据之和是:103。
案例解析:
1、在定义名称中,引用位置用到了GET.CELL宏函数。
2、=GET.CELL(63,Sheet1!A1:G10),公式中的参数“63”的意思是:单元格填充颜色(背景)编码数字权。
3、=SUMIF(A12:G21,3,A1:G10),公式中的参数“3”,是红色对应的
cell(info_type,[reference])
reference:是单元格zhidao,如A1,A2,B5等等
info_type:有很多可选例如type
=CELL("type",A1)
这个表示如果A1单元格是空的话,这个值返回内"b"
如果A1单元格是数值的话,这个返回"v"
如果A1单元格是文本如"abdwer",返回"l"
infor_type可选的参数可以上百度百容科上面去查"CELL函数"
CELL
返回某一引用区域的左知上角单元格的格式、道位置或内容等信息。
http://office.microsoft.com/zh-cn/excel-help/HP005209008.aspx?CTT=1
语法
CELL(info_type,reference)
Info_type 为一个文本值,指定所专需要的单元格信息的类型。下面列出属 info_type 的可能值及相应的结果。